WASHINGTON, March 20 /U.S. Newswire/ -- "Citizens of South Dakota should be proud of their courageous legislators for making history by being the first state to create a law that bans all surgical abortions without exception," said Jim Sedlak, vice- president of American Life League. "American Life League salutes these men and women for their heroic actions that will certainly make a lasting impact for the pro-life cause."

American Life League is running a full-page ad in today's Pierre Capital Journal commending the 73 South Dakota lawmakers who voted in favor of HR 1215 as well as Governor Mike Rounds, who signed the bill into law. The ad thanks both the elected officials and citizens of South Dakota for "putting a smile on the face of pro-life America."
